About 17 Belmont Avenue
17 Belmont Avenue is a semi-detached house in Middlesbrough (TS5 8EN). It has a recorded floor area of 75 m² (around 807 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(June 2022) shows an E (score 52),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 71), a 2-band jump.
Untraded for 20 years, with the last transfer in March 2006.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 75%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£178,000 is 30.9% above the 2006 sale price.
